In these listings a three-tier (three-shelf) design is most common—3-tier rolling carts and bookshelves are frequently offered for book and utility storage.
Carts typically use four swivel casters for easy maneuvering, often 360-degree swivel types. Many models include lockable wheels (commonly two lockable casters) so the cart can be secured when stationary.
Per-tier capacities in these listings range from about 10 pounds up to roughly 33 pounds. Some designs report total load capacities of around 130–132.5 pounds.
Assembly requirements differ by model: some carts arrive ready to use with no assembly or are tool-free, while others require adult assembly and include the necessary tools.
These carts are presented as versatile: common uses include home libraries, classrooms, offices or studies, and household areas like kitchens, bathrooms, and bedrooms. Some models are also marketed for utility tasks such as grocery or errand transport.
